Overview
The 90-minute Outta Control Dinner Show in Orlando is a one-of-a-kind experience which entertains audiences of all ages. You won't just watch the show, you'll be part of it as audience participation is as much a part of the night as the improv comedy performances. The hilarious show will keep you on the edge of your seat and tickle your funny bone every 8 seconds!

Enjoyable show.
TJ was our magician and was a funny guy .
The magic itself was entertaining with some audience participation.
The venue was quite grotty - think along the lines of a village hall with a sticky floor . You are sat on long tables with other guests which is quite sociable.
Salad was basic but ok .
Pizza was reasonably good , and plenty of it - its a large 8 slice pizza and served as half Margarita and half Pepperoni. You can have mire pizza if you want it .
Free soft drinks are topped up regularly.
Basic chocolate cake for dessert.
Our tickets were included with our vacation package.
2 adult and 2 kids tickets work out at $115 - is it worth it - i would say not , however we did enjoy the hour long show which started at 6pm and finished at 7pm.
The servers were pleasant - we had a guy called Ryan who did a good job and had a good attitude.
Remember to tip the servers.
